Try NowThe National Testing Agency (NTA) announced the Re-National Eligibility cum Entrance Test Undergraduate (Re-NEET UG) 2026 results on the official website of NEET at neet.nta.nic.in. Over 20 lakh applicants can check the Re-NEET scores by using the details, including application number, password/date of birth & security pin. 138 candidates scored above 690 marks out of 720. Of these over 93 per cent appeared for NEET (UG) for the first time, 99 per cent are between 17 and 19 years of age. NEET result LIVE updates.
Along with the NEET UG result 2026, the agency has also released the cut-off list on the official website. The NEET UG 2026 re-examination was held on June 21, and the OMR sheet was released on July 13, 2026.

Women candidates outperform men
Women accounted for more than 58 per cent of the candidates who qualified NEET UG 2026. They also recorded a higher qualification rate than men, with 56.8 per cent of female candidates clearing the examination compared to 55.1 per cent of male candidates.

RE-NEET score distribution
The highest score of 715 out of 720 was obtained jointly by Aryan Gupta (Punjab) and Panshul Bansal (Haryana).
| Score Range | Number of Candidates |
| Above 700 | 19 |
| 650 and above | 1,492 |
| 600 and above | 10,160 |
| 500 and above | 90,780 |
| Highest Score | 715/720 |
| Highest Scorers | Aryan Gupta (Punjab), Panshul Bansal (Haryana) |
Students found the Re-NEET UG 2026 paper to be of moderate difficulty . Physics was the lengthiest section, while Biology was largely NCERT-based and Chemistry was moderate.

From 2027 onwards, NEET will be conducted in the Computer-Based Test (CBT) format. The announcement was made soon after the May 3 NEET UG 2026 exam was cancelled due to paper leak allegations.
Meanwhile, NMC has announced 1,36,939 MBBS seats for the 2026-27 admission cycle , adding 9,911 new seats. Over 78% of the increase is in private medical colleges.
